What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an HR Employee Relations Specialist, and why are they important?

To thrive as an HR Employee Relations Specialist, you need a solid understanding of employment law, conflict resolution, and HR best practices, often supported by a degree in human resources or a related field. Familiarity with HR information systems (HRIS), case management software, and certification such as SHRM or PHR is highly valued. Exceptional interpersonal skills, active listening, and discretion are crucial soft skills for building trust and effectively handling sensitive workplace issues. These competencies are vital for ensuring a fair, compliant, and harmonious work environment while reducing organizational risk.

Key Responsibilities

โ€ข Provide personal care, including bathing, grooming, oral hygiene, shampoos, and changing bed linens

โ€ข Assist with dressing, toileting, and mobility needs

โ€ข Plan and prepare nutritious meals; assist with feeding as needed

โ€ข Take and record vital signs (temperature, pulse, respiration, blood pressure) when ordered

โ€ข Perform range of motion exercises and simple therapy procedures as instructed

โ€ข Monitor and report changes in patient condition to the supervising nurse

โ€ข Maintain a clean, safe, and comfortable environment for patients

โ€ข Offer emotional support and companionship to patients and families

โ€ข Provide respite care for family/caregivers when appropriate

โ€ข Participate in care planning, team meetings, and quality improvement activities

โ€ข Adhere to documentation standards and professional conduct guidelines
